dc.description.abstractThis document and project has the purpose of developing a system able to help blind people orient themselves using computer vision techniques. Computer vision is becoming increasingly essential to our everyday lives; it is heavily used across the automation of industries, medical imaging, as well as self-driving vehicles such as cars and drones. When associated to artificial intelligence, computer vision techniques enable the algorithms to do wonders, as a matter of facts it is used this way in most cases nowadays. The project’s goal is to grab images from a helmet mounted on the head of a blind person, composed of a camera, an embedded computer and an audio headset, those images are then analyzed on the embedded computer in real time to make guesses on the position of the followed person or object in that image, the position is then described to the helmet wearer by a sound. The embedded computer is equipped with a remote desktop server and therefore a graphical user interface has been made to choose and set parameters for the computer vision software, such as which algorithm to use and what object or person to follow.
